GeoGuessr : Daily Challenge, November 5, 2024

10 months ago
23

This is the GeoGuessr's Daily Challenge for November 5th, 2024

Locations
1. Argentina
2. U.S.A.
3. Iceland
4. Bulgaria
5. Israel

Loading 1 comment...